Key Points

  • This study aims to enhance multimodal named entity recognition by addressing issues in text-image alignment and entity representation.
  • Proposed a contrastive uncertainty-aware framework (CUA-MNER) for MNER.
  • Implemented hierarchical vision-text alignment for improved token, phrase, and sentence correspondences.
  • Used variational uncertainty-aware fusion to manage modality contributions and enhance entity recognition.
  • Achieved F1 scores of 76.97% and 89.66% on Twitter2015 and Twitter2017 benchmarks, respectively.
  • Outperformed competitive baselines by 0.66 and 1.95 F1 points.
  • Identified that the model's components provide complementary benefits, indicating robustness in multimodal recognition.
